In historical numeral systems

Egyptian

2 coils of rope, 3 hobbles, 9 strokes

2 × 100 + 3 × 10 + 9 × 1 = 239. The signs are simply repeated and added; where they sit on the line is a matter of layout, not value.

Babylonian

3 vertical wedges (sixties place), 5 corner wedges + 9 vertical wedges (units place)

3 × 60 + 59 = 239. Places are separated by a space on the tablet, with the higher place written first.

Greek (Ionic)

sigma, then lambda, then theta, marked as a numeral

sigma-lambda-theta + keraia

sigma + lambda + theta written in descending order and added — the letters carry their values wherever they stand, so this is addition, not place value.

Hebrew numerals

resh, then lamed, then tet

resh-lamed-tet

resh (200) + lamed (30) + tet (9) = 239, written in descending order.

Maya

2 bars + 1 dot (upper, twenties place) over 3 bars + 4 dots (lower, units place)

11 × 20 + 19 = 239. Places stack vertically with the smallest at the bottom, so the upper group is worth twenty times the lower.

Science

  • Plutonium-239 is produced by neutron capture in uranium-238 rather than mined. Its 24,100-year half-life and fissile properties make reactor-grade separation a proliferation concern.

What is 239 in Roman numerals?

239 in Roman numerals is CCXXXIX. IX is subtractive: one before ten — ten minus one. Written additively it would be CCXXXVIIII, which Roman inscriptions used freely — the strict subtractive form is a later convention.
